Recognizing Membrane Switch Modern Technology



Membrane switch innovation might appear facility, it operates on straightforward principles that enhance customer interfaces in numerous devices. This technology contains slim, flexible layers that create an incorporated circuit, permitting for seamless communication between the customer and the tool. Normally, a membrane switch makes up a graphic overlay, a spacer, and a circuit layer, all developed to give a effective and long lasting option for regulating digital functions.The graphic overlay, usually printed with vibrant styles, supplies visual assistance while serving as the key touch surface. Under it, the spacer layer keeps the circuit layer and overlay divided till pressure is applied, finishing the circuit. When a user presses a button, the layers come right into call, causing an electric signal that activates the device. This simplicity, incorporated with versatility, enables Membrane buttons to be efficiently utilized in a large range of applications, from consumer electronic devices to industrial equipment.
